Being a young person is hard work; not to mention the added stress of keeping up with friends, family, social media, school, work, dealing with difficult people, and other things that can impact your day-to-day functioning. Counseling can be helpful for coping with daily stress and is good for your mind and body. It’s important to take advantage of the counseling services made available to you, both in and out of care.
